Built-in microwaves aren't installed on counters. Instead, they are built into cabinets, drawers, or installed above the range. They are typically more expensive and require professional installation.

If you are frequently hosting guests or cook for large families A double oven can make all the difference. Double ovens are great for juggling multiple dishes that need to be cooked at various temperatures and timings. This is especially useful when you are cooking a meal that requires roasting meats, while baking a delicate dessert. You can easily cook these two recipes simultaneously with a double-oven and microwave.
There are various sizes available for double wall ovens and ranges so you can find the perfect one for your home. The most common dimension is a 24-36 inch compartment, which is spacious enough to hold most dishes and pans. If you're looking to cook more elaborate dishes you may want to consider larger models that come with a 39-inch or 42-inch space.

Depending on the size of your household and the type of food you cook the most frequently it is possible to select the double oven with a large or standard internal capacity. The internal capacity is an indication of how much food can be stored in the appliance and the efficiency. For example, a large oven is likely to require more energy to heat than a smaller one, so it is important to consider your cooking requirements and needs when deciding on a choice.
When you are looking for a double oven make sure you choose models that have high energy efficiency ratings and are well-insulated to keep heat in and reduce energy usage. Explore models with alternative cleaning methods, so that you can avoid using self-cleaning cycles that use high heat, which can increase the amount of energy consumed.

If you're looking to simplify cooking tasks or make room for a decorative hood, you'll find plenty of style options in microwave and double wall ovens. Double wall ovens are ideal for those who enjoy baking dishes that require different temperatures or settings that allow you to bake delicate fish in the top oven while roasting vegetables at a higher heat in the lower oven. Microwave oven combos offer additional storage space while also freeing up space above your cooktop for the installation of a vent hood.
